polymelia

Filipino child with an additional set of legs. Polymelia is a birth defect involving limbs (a type of dysmelia), in which the affected individual has more than the usual number of limbs. In humans and most land-dwelling animals, this means having five or more limbs. The extra limb is most commonly shrunken and/or deformed. Sometimes an embryo started as conjoined twins, but one twin degenerated completely except for one or more limbs, which end up attached to the other twin. No photographer credited, undated.
